(1) The licensee shall ensure that at least one on-duty staff person has:
- (a) basic first training;
- (b) Heimlich maneuver training;
- (c) CPR training; and
- (d) is trained in emergency procedures to ensure that each resident receives prompt first aid as needed.
(2) The licensee shall ensure:
- (a) a first aid kit is available at a specified location in the facility; and
- (b) a current edition of a basic first aid manual approved by the American Red Cross, the American Medical Association, or a state or federal health agency is available at a specified location in the facility.
- (3) The licensee shall ensure each facility has an OSHA Administration approved clean-up kit for blood-borne pathogens.
